How they compare
Gambia currently reports 100.1% against 99.9% in Honduras, a difference of 0.2%.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 7 shared years of data; in 2006 it was Gambia ahead.
Gambia ranks 72nd and Honduras ranks 74th of 174 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Gambia averaged higher in 2 and Honduras in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Gambia | Honduras |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 107.7% | 106.2% | 1.5% | Gambia |
| 2010s | 99.8% | 97.3% | 2.5% | Gambia |
| 2020s | 61.5% | 101.1% | 39.6% | Honduras |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
